What is pain? Is it just one thing, always undesirable, or does it have other qualities? Is it useful, at times even necessary? What is it like to live with chronic pain? 7 Facets: A Meditation on Pain is a short ebook about pain, its qualities, roles and impact on the people who live with it every day. Created as a poem in prose, this lyrical exploration of a difficult topic shines a light on an aspect of life which we prefer to ignore. Author Lene Andersen has lived with rheumatoid arthritis and chronic pain for over four decades. She uses this experience to delve deep within the meaning and essence of pain. 7 Facets: A Meditation on Pain is guaranteed to resonate with those who live with chronic pain and to help others better understand the realities of living with this condition.
